The celebrations for Dino Crisis players continue thanks toDino Crisis: Rebirth.
Let’s be honest,Dino Crisis: Rebirthlooks amazing
It should go without saying, but just on the off-chance I’ve not been clear enough already - this is a fan-made remake, not an officialCapcomone.
